About this piece

A contemporary tonal divertimento that looks back at classical formal structures. It is characterized by clean, transparent textures and traditional harmonic progressions.

What makes it challenging

At Henle 4 this is an intermediate piece that expects secure technique and real attention to phrasing. The main demands: a true singing tone, with the melody floating above the accompaniment; chord voicing — bringing out one note inside a handful of others; and precise articulation — the difference between crisp and blurred is the piece.

Teacher notes

Focus on achieving a singing tone (cantabile) despite the spare and transparent texture.

How hard is Divertimento in C major by Daniel Léo Simpson?

Divertimento in C major is rated Henle level 4 of 9 — intermediate repertoire, roughly ABRSM grades 5–6. In the RCM system it corresponds to about level 5.

What level do I need to play Divertimento in C major?

You should be comfortable at Henle level 4 — meaning you can already play level 3–4 pieces cleanly. Learning it one level early is possible as a stretch piece, but more than that usually leads to months of frustration.
